description
The Language Academy at the University of Central Lancashire organises a range of courses for international students, language teachers and professional clients. The majority of the Language Academy's students are undergraduates from UCLan’s partner institutions in China, S. Korea and Japan, we also have students from other parts of the world and our clientele is expanding year on year. In addition to university students, we also run courses for language teachers and other professional people such as business people.
In most cases, the Language Academy offers international students and other clients a package consisting of tuition, accommodation and leisure activities. We therefore need a reliable, local provider of high-quality accommodation to meet the sometimes quite exacting requirements of our students and clients. Students will usually stay in the accommodation for periods of between one and eight weeks, though we do sometimes have courses lasting several months.
The majority of Language Academy courses take place during UCLan’s summer vacation, between late June and the end of August, in addition we have smaller numbers of students requiring accommodation year-round. The highest volume of accommodation required at any one time is likely to be around 160 single rooms in the mid-summer period. We are usually able to provide outline accommodation requirements about three months in advance and fairly firm numbers at least a month before the accommodation is required but the nature of our business means that we are not always able to provide completely accurate figures until closer to course dates.
We are also looking to source the same type of accommodation, though on a smaller scale, between late January and March, when we run a Winter school for students from S.E. Asia. Highest volume at this time is likely to be 50-60 single rooms.
Since accommodation plays such a significant role in an international student’s experience here in Preston, we are looking for a provider who has experience of working with international students, is sympathetic to aspects of cultural difference and can provide a welcoming, secure and comfortable environment.
